Essential Service Water System Modification General This modification was performed to add 14" boundary valves and 1" drain valves to the Essential Service Water and Containment Cooling systems to facilitate local leak rate testing and valve repairs without taking the entire A or B essential service water train out of service, Procedure Review The NRC inspector reviewed the following procedures:

CVCS Letdown Heat Exchanger Nozzle Examinations In September 1987, the licensee was notified that it had received two CVCS letdown heat exchangers from a manufacturer of a heat exchanger that had developed a crack in the inlet nozzle, at another facility. The crack developed as a result of grinding grooves left by the manufacturer. The heat exchanger purchased under P.O. No. 546-CAZ-240543-BM was installed in Unit 1, and the heat exchanger purchased under P.O. No. 546-CAZ-240545-BM was sold to Anderson Underground Construction in Centerville, Missouri for scra The licensee initiated a program to inspect the Unit 1 inlet and outlet CVCS letdown heat exchanger nozzles. The acceptance criteria was based on the failure analysis of the cracked nozzle and the ASME code. Visual and liquid penetrant examinations revealed no indication . Training and Qualification Effectiveness An evaluation of training and qualification effectiveness was made during the inspection. The evaluation included discussions with ISI personnel and observations of ISI personnel performance during work activitie On occasions ISI personnel were observed during discontinuity evaluatio Their performance during such evaluation demonstrated ability to identify and evaluate discontinuities, and is indicative of effective trainin The ISI personnel appear to be knowledgeable of industry practice .
